An irrevocable trust is a trust that cannot be modified or terminated without the permission of the beneficiary. In most states, a trust will be deemed irrevocable unless the Trustor specifies otherwise. Once the Trustor has transferred assets into the trust, s/he has no rights of ownership to the assets and the trust. Irrevocable trusts are preferred because it removes all incidents of ownership, thereby effectively removing the trust's assets from the grantor's taxable estate. The Trustor is also relieved of the tax liability on the income generated by the assets. This is the opposite of a "revocable trust", which allows the Trustor to modify the trust.
A Pot Trust is a trust set up for more than one beneficiary, typically children. The purpose of a Pot Trust is to keep the funds in one pot until a later event. For example, at the death of the parents, the assets may be kept in one pot until all the children have graduated from college or reached age 21.
The Phoenix Arizona Irrevocable Pot Trust Agreement is a legally binding document that establishes a trust for the purpose of holding and distributing assets in Phoenix, Arizona. This specialized trust agreement is designed to provide individuals with a reliable and flexible tool for managing their assets and ensuring their distribution to the intended beneficiaries. At its core, an Irrevocable Pot Trust Agreement allows individuals to transfer their assets into a trust, which is then managed by a designated trustee. The irrevocable nature of the trust ensures that the assets held within it cannot be altered or revoked by the granter. This provides a significant level of asset protection, as the trust assets are shielded from creditors, lawsuits, and other external threats. The Phoenix Arizona Irrevocable Pot Trust Agreement is a versatile estate planning tool that provides several benefits. Firstly, it allows the granter to maintain control over how their assets are distributed, ensuring that the beneficiaries receive their inheritance according to the granter's wishes. Additionally, the trust agreement can include provisions for tax planning, ensuring that the assets are distributed in a tax-efficient manner. There are various types of Phoenix Arizona Irrevocable Pot Trust Agreements that individuals can choose from, depending on their specific needs and objectives: 1. Standard Phoenix Arizona Irrevocable Pot Trust Agreement: This is the basic form of the trust agreement, providing flexibility and asset protection while allowing the granter to determine the beneficiaries and distribution terms. 2. Special Needs Phoenix Arizona Irrevocable Pot Trust Agreement: This type of trust is specifically designed for individuals with special needs or disabilities. It allows the granter to provide ongoing financial support to the beneficiary while preserving their eligibility for government benefits such as Medicaid. 3. Charitable Phoenix Arizona Irrevocable Pot Trust Agreement: This trust agreement is specifically created for charitable purposes. The granter can direct the trustee to distribute a portion or all of the trust assets to designated charitable organizations, promoting philanthropy and leaving a lasting impact on the community. 4. Spendthrift Phoenix Arizona Irrevocable Pot Trust Agreement: This type of trust agreement is ideal for individuals concerned about the financial stability and responsibility of their beneficiaries. It allows the granter to place restrictions on the distribution of trust assets, protecting them from potential creditors and ensuring a controlled and steady income stream for the beneficiaries.
